The Bearded Collie and Texas Heeler mix is a crossbreed between two popular dog breeds: the Bearded Collie and the Texas Heeler. The Bearded Collie is a long-haired herding dog known for its intelligence, agility, and friendly nature. On the other hand, the Texas Heeler is a mix between the Australian Cattle Dog and the Australian Shepherd, prized for its herding abilities and loyalty.
When you combine these two breeds, you get a dog that is not only intelligent and agile but also loyal and protective. The Bearded Collie and Texas Heeler mix is an excellent choice for families looking for a versatile and hardworking dog that can excel in various roles.
The Bearded Collie and Texas Heeler mix is a medium to large-sized dog with a sturdy build and a dense coat. They typically have a long, flowing coat that requires regular grooming to prevent tangling and matting. Their coat can come in a variety of colors, including black, brown, and white, with speckles or patches of color.
These dogs have a friendly and outgoing personality, making them excellent companions for families with children. They are known for their playful nature and love for outdoor activities. The Bearded Collie and Texas Heeler mix are also highly intelligent and eager to please, making them easy to train and quick learners.
Due to their herding instincts, these dogs may exhibit a strong prey drive and may try to herd small children or other pets. Early socialization and training are essential to help them channel their instincts in a positive way.
The Bearded Collie and Texas Heeler mix are known for their friendly and gentle demeanor. They are loyal and protective towards their families, making them excellent watchdogs. However, they are not typically aggressive unless provoked.
These dogs thrive on human companionship and do not do well when left alone for long periods. They are highly social animals that enjoy being part of the family activities. The Bearded Collie and Texas Heeler mix are also great with children and other pets, especially when raised together from a young age.
Due to their herding background, these dogs may have a tendency to nip or chase after moving objects. It is essential to provide them with plenty of exercise and mental stimulation to prevent boredom and behavioral issues. Regular walks, playtime, and training sessions are all necessary to keep them happy and healthy.
When it comes to grooming, the Bearded Collie and Texas Heeler mix require regular brushing to prevent matting and tangles. Their dense coat should be brushed at least a few times a week to keep it looking neat and healthy. They may also require occasional trimming to maintain a tidy appearance.
In terms of exercise, these dogs are highly energetic and require plenty of physical activity to stay healthy and happy. Daily walks, play sessions, and agility training are all great ways to keep them entertained and mentally stimulated. They also enjoy participating in dog sports such as obedience trials, agility, and flyball.
Training is crucial for the Bearded Collie and Texas Heeler mix, as they are intelligent and independent dogs. Positive reinforcement methods are recommended to help them learn commands and behaviors effectively. Consistent training and socialization will help them become well-rounded and obedient companions.
